What word is for eyeglasses that contain two prescriptions per lens?
Len [333]

Answer:

bifocals

Explanation:

Prescription bifocals (sometimes called “lined bifocals”) typically contain two corrective powers within the same lens and can correct both nearsightedness and farsightedness.
